Lionhead Studios released these images of Fable 2, to show how you can dress your characters in different variations. The game is planned to be released in the end of October.

Fable 2 in experimental stage even with the game well into developement
Fable 2 plans to have no HUD, no health bar, no hit points and no screen tutorials
Fable 2 will provide help to player with whats in the game
Wealth exchange will be a large part of Fable 2 gameplay
Combat will be more dramatic than realistic
Combat will involve interaction with environment objects as well as weapons
Fable 2 is aiming for interaction to a level that a woman can get pregnant through sexual process, get pregnant, carry the baby and deliver the child in the game itself
Character can then control and parent his or her child and make them grow in the way you want, good bad strong weak shy etc etc
